image
Healthcare - Biotechnology - NASDAQ - CH
$ 5.03
10.1 %
$ 185 M
Market Cap
-2.38
P/E
MOLN - DEPRECIATION & AMORTIZATION

Depreciation & Amortization MOLN - Molecular Partners AG

image
2.42 M
LAST VALUE
-2.87%
2 YEAR CAGR
21.24%
5 YEAR CAGR
11.80%
10 YEAR CAGR